Well, that's officially changed as the previously largest unnamed body in the solar system is now officially Gonggong, named for a Chinese water god with the head of a human and the body of a snake!

The pair make up the first major solar system bodies to have Chinese names, according to astrophysicist Simon Porter.

The dwarf planet 2007 OR10 is officially Gonggong (龚工).

It's the first major solar system body with a Chinese name.
